Candle Divination

Candle gazing, also known as "Trataka" in some spiritual traditions, is a form of concentrated meditation and divination. It involves fixing one's gaze on a candle flame without blinking, with the intention of developing focus, clarity, and intuitive insights. Over time, practitioners might experience visions, heightened intuition, or profound insights, making it a form of divination. It takes time and practice to develop a relationship with this practice. Below is a guide to understanding how a flame can communicate with you. Like all spiritual practices, your intuition and your unique connection to source will provide you the clearest messages this can help you connect!

  • Steady Flame: A strong, steady flame suggests a strong presence, concentrated energy, or that the environment is free from disturbances. In divination, it could signify that your intentions are clear and the energies are supportive of your query.

  • Jumping Flame: A flame that jumps or flickers frequently may indicate strong emotions or the presence of spirits or other energies. It could suggest unrest, resistance, or interruptions in the flow of energy related to the divinatory question.

  • Dancing Flame: If the flame sways or dances, it can suggest that you are in touch with greater forces or energies. It may indicate that you should be open to messages from higher realms or be aware of underlying currents in a situation.

  • Small or Low Flame: A flame that remains low suggests that you may be facing opposition or blockages. In divination, it could mean there's a need to build more energy or that there's resistance to the question at hand.

  • Blue Flame: A blue flame is a sign of spiritual presence and can indicate that communication with spiritual realms is more accessible at that moment. Blue can also symbolize healing energy.

  • Twin Flames: Occasionally, a candle flame will split into two or more flames. If this occurs, it could represent outside influences or multiple energies or forces at play regarding the divinatory question.

  • Popping or Cracking Flame: If the flame pops or crackles, it may signify communication from spirits or the presence of energetic interferences. Pay attention to intuitive messages or feelings when this happens.

  • No Flame: If the candle refuses to light or has difficulty staying lit, it may suggest significant opposition or that the time isn't right for the divination.
